Resumo: Change is undoubtedly a fundamental phenomenon, which allows the renewal and preservation of the language over time. As a product and producer of a given society, it is natural for language to accompany her dynamism. Linguistic changes take place primarily in speech, especially in informal contexts, where there is a lower level of monitoring and a reduced distance between the speaker and his interlocutor. It is in everyday speech that the sender has the freedom to access the potentialities of the system and to dare in the elaboration of new words, aiming at the improvement of the communication. This process of linguistic creation and renewal is called neology. Its product, in turn, is called the neologism. In this perspective, when adopting the neologism as object of study, we look for a corpus that would allow the extraction of a significant number of neological lexias present in the present Portuguese. Thus, we selected 70 copies of the popular Bahia Massa! newspaper, referring to the months of January to March of 2015, which present in their headlines, calls and titles several neological lexias constant in the speech of their public-reader. We base the research on the analysis and classification of the 203 new words detected, based on theoretical studies based on neology and lexicology of the Portuguese language. The identification of the neological character was made from current dictionaries, such as Houaiss (2009), Aur?lio (2010) and Dicio (online). The parameter for the organization of the data consisted of: a) grammatical classification, b) meaning, c) type of formation process, d) contexts in which they appear along the copies. This procedure allowed us to observe that the most frequent type of neologism in the corpus is the formal one, and the most productive lexical process is the semantic one. In addition, it was possible to verify that the creation of neologisms by the speakers occurs in a systematic way, in informal contexts of communication and with a definite purpose, that is, of propagating ideas and concepts.
